Following APWs, RRT staff now insured under Group Life Insurance Scheme

Coimbatore : Continuing with the Group Life Insurance scheme that was implemented in the Coimbatore Forest Division last year for Anti-Poaching Watchers (APW), the Western Ghats Wildlife Conservation Trust (WGWCT) that offered the scheme has now included members of the Rapid Response Team (RRT), this year.

The scheme will cover treatment for medical emergencies and even fatalities of 146 beneficiaries, including 136 APWs and 10 RRT staff. “The beneficiaries can claim up to Rs.1 lakh for medical emergencies under the scheme. In case of fatalities, the victim’s family will get Rs.1.5 lakhs,” said N Parthiban, President of WGWCT which would be paying the premium amount for the life insurance scheme.

Commenting about extending the insurance policy to RRT members, Parthiban said that the idea was thought of after the unfortunate death of RRT member R Venkatesh, who was killed by the tusker Vinayakan during an anti-depredation activity at Thadagam in October 2018. Venkatesh’s family was compensated up to Rs.8 lakhs by the State Government. “The scheme was initially introduced after two APWs from the Madukkarai Range were seriously injured by a wild elephant in 2017. The staff were initially helped through crowd funding as they had no insurance coverage despite being in a dangerous job,” he said. 

He further added that such schemes were of utmost importance to forest staff who risk their lives chasing elephants, roaming inside thick forests and living inside huts in forests, all in the call of duty. The policy certificates were handed over to District Forest Officer D. Venkatesh on Monday.
